Synthesis And Biological Activity Research Of Schiff Bases And Its Metal Complexes

Superoxide dismutase,as one kind of metalloenzyme,exists widely in the organism,which has extensive prospects in the application for it plays an important role in protecting the body from the toxic effect of superoxide anion radical.But the disadvantages of lower stability ,macro molecular weight,lower penetrability and immunogenic property restrict it's application.So the researches of SOD have been being paid close attention to by scientists and engineers.In this paper,the new Schiff bases of thiadiazole and its Cu(Ⅱ),Co(Ⅱ),Zn(Ⅱ) complexes were synthesized, and the properties of catalytic activity of the metal complexes in disproportionation of O2― were studied.2-amino-1,3,4-thiadiazole-5-thiol has great coordination capability and good biological activities.We synthesized four new Schiff base ligands by the condensation of 2-amino-1,3,4-thiadiazole-5-thiol and [(2-amino-1,3,4-thiadiazole-5-yl)thio]acetic acid separately with salicylaldehyde and 2,4-dihydroxybenzaldehyde,and got their Cu(Ⅱ),Co(Ⅱ),Zn(Ⅱ) quadridentate complexes.All the compounds were characterized by elemental analysis,IR spectrum,UV-vis spectrum,atomic spectrum and molar conductance measurements.The tests of catalytic activity of all the complexes, determined by NBT method ,indicate that:(1)All the complexes show some inhibitive effects to O2―,and the activities have close correlation with the kinds of metal.(2)In the metal complexes of each ligand, the copper(Ⅱ) complex has the best activity.The possible reasion is that the copper(Ⅱ) itself has some inhibitive effects to the O2― ,and copper(Ⅱ) can carry out the process of being deoxidized to copper(Ⅰ), which simulates the really catalytic process of disproportionation of O2― in Cu/Zn-SOD well;(3)The copper(Ⅱ) complexes have different catalytic mechanism with the cobalt(Ⅱ) and zinc(Ⅱ) complexes in disproportionation of O2―; The activities of copper(Ⅱ) complexes behave logarithmic correlation with the concentration,(4)The activities of all the metal complexes have the direct correction with their concentration,and they all behave the better inhibitive effects than the SOD reported in concerned literature in the same mass concentration.We concluded that the configurations of copper(Ⅱ) complexes are similar to the planar square coordination ofCu/Zn-SOD's. (5)In the effects of compositive factors,the metal complexes behave different activities.In the copper(Ⅱ) complexes of four ligands, the complex 4a has the best activity in lower concentration,but in the higher concentration, complex 2a does. In the cobalt(Ⅱ) complexes of four ligands, the complex 1b has the best activity. In the zinc(Ⅱ) complexes of four ligands, the complex 4c shows the best activity.
